5KP54C-B Product Overview

Introduction

The 5KP54C-B is a high-performance transient voltage suppressor (TVS) diode designed to protect sensitive electronic equipment from voltage transients induced by lightning and other transient voltage events. This entry provides an in-depth overview of the 5KP54C-B, including its product category, basic information, specifications, pin configuration, functional features, advantages and disadvantages, working principles, application field plans, and alternative models.

Product Category

The 5KP54C-B belongs to the TVS diode category, specifically designed for surge protection applications in various electronic systems.

Basic Information Overview

  • Use: Surge protection against transient voltage events.
  • Characteristics: High surge capability, low clamping voltage, fast response time.
  • Package: Axial leaded package.
  • Essence: Safeguarding sensitive electronic components from voltage transients.
  • Packaging/Quantity: Available in tape and reel packaging with varying quantities.

Specifications

  • Peak Pulse Power: 5000 W
  • Standoff Voltage: 54 V
  • Breakdown Voltage: 60 V
  • Maximum Clamping Voltage: 87.1 V
  • Operating Temperature Range: -55°C to +175°C
  • Storage Temperature Range: -55°C to +175°C

Working Principles

The 5KP54C-B operates by diverting excessive transient current away from sensitive electronic components, thereby limiting the voltage across the protected circuit.
